Limited Access In Windows 7 Is Removed For 3 Apps !
Microsoft has withdrawn its limited access of Windows 7 Starter Edition for three applications at a time. This is said by the observer and author Paul Thurrott. Despite it doesn’t appear to include allow to change wallpapers, the limit will be removed from the edition.

The main reason for changing the three app limit is to open the door for stronger competition from Android and other Linux-Based operating systems, which are running on netbooks as they come free of cost or at lower cost. In other side, mobile internet devices and iPod touch have enforced Microsoft to make the costs low.
